2011-06-21 3 views
0

J'ai une question selon la programmation du capteur. Je cherche un capteur qui me dit, par exemple, si un verre d'eau est à moitié plein. Je l'ai déjà googlé, mais je ne trouve rien. Donc mes questions sont:programmation du capteur

  • Où puis-je acheter un tel capteur?
  • De quel langage de programmation ai-je besoin pour contrôler un tel capteur?

Merci pour les réponses ..

mise à jour des commentaires ci-dessous l'une des réponses

Ce que j'ai vraiment besoin pour un grand récipient, ce qui est un peu de maïs. I veulent utiliser le capteur pour me dire, tout comme le maïs est sous un point défini du conteneur. Alors que je peux calculer, à quel moment j'ai pour remplir le récipient.

Répondre

0

Connaissez-vous la taille du verre en question? Vous pourriez juste obtenir une échelle et déterminer combien le verre serait lourd quand il est à moitié plein d'eau. Je pense que vous pouvez probablement trouver un capteur qui pourrait le faire et il serait très probablement besoin d'être écrit en C.

Ce gars semble avoir les mêmes problèmes:

http://forums.makezine.com/comments.php?DiscussionID=6052

Bonne la chance.

Consultez également Arduino pour l'électronique du microcontrôleur.

+0

Ok, merci ... Mais l'exemple avec le verre d'eau n'était qu'un exemple. Ce dont j'ai vraiment besoin c'est d'un gros contenant dans lequel il y a du maïs. Je veux utiliser le capteur pour me dire, tout comme le maïs est sous un point défini du récipient. Alors que je peux calculer, à quel moment je dois remplir le récipient. Savez-vous ce que je veux dire? – Harald

+0

@Harald, je dirais que votre meilleur plan serait d'utiliser un faisceau infrarouge qui, lorsqu'il est connecté au capteur, vous permettra de savoir que le conteneur est vide à ce niveau. Je veux dire par là que vous avez un faisceau infrarouge traversant le diamètre du conteneur et un récepteur de l'autre côté. Ils ne seront pas en mesure de se connecter alors qu'il y a du maïs à l'intérieur mais quand il est vide ils se connecteront en complétant votre "circuit" – stuartmclark

0

"Ce dont j'ai vraiment besoin c'est d'un gros contenant dans lequel il y a du maïs." Il se peut que l'un des capteurs utilisés pour assurer l'entrée dans le garage soit dégagé avant qu'une porte de garage automatique puisse se fermer. Il utilise un faisceau de lumière optique.

+0

Oui, j'ai déjà pensé à quelque chose comme une barrière lumineuse. Mais je ne sais pas, s'il y a un moyen, de le connecter avec un PC ... – Harald

1

Votre capteur peut être un capteur de niveau. Il existe plusieurs principes sur lesquels fonctionnent les capteurs de niveau (see here). Certains d'entre eux vont travailler avec des matériaux solides granulaires. (Par exemple, un capteur de portée ultrasonique pourrait déclencher une impulsion à la surface de la masse de maïs, détecter la réflexion, mesurer le temps de vol aller-retour.)

, comme on l'avait suggéré plus haut .

... ou il peut s'agir d'un capteur de poids. Si vous cherchez un "capteur de niveau pour grains", vous trouverez peut-être quelque chose d'utile.

La langue à utiliser dépend de la connexion à laquelle vous souhaitez connecter le capteur. Si elle sera connectée à un microcontrôleur, la langue serait C. Si elle sera connectée à un PC, cela dépendra beaucoup du modèle particulier du capteur. En passant, voici un web group dedicated to sensors.

Questions connexes